Bulk charge time estimation
Consumer batteries charging (ignition key
OFF, position 0 or position I) :
•
State of charge from 50% to 80%:
Around 45 minutes.*
•
State of charge from 60% to 80%:
Around 30 minutes.*
•
State of charge from 70% to 80%:
Around 15 minutes.*
Consumer batteries and starter batteries
charging (ignition key on position II), at
this position +DR power line is activated
causing a higher consumption (lower current
charging the batteries):
•
Starter and Consumer Batteries with state
of charge from 50% to 80%: Around 6
hours.*
•
Starter and Consumer Batteries with state
of charge from 60% to 80%: Around 4
hours.*
•
Starter and Consumer Batteries with state
of charge from 70% to 80%: Around 2
hours.*
* Considering SOH (State Of Health) 100%
and 25 °C.
The values were estimated and may vary
according to specific conditions.
